White City, Saskatchewan
White City is a town in the Canadian province of Saskatchewan. White City is 14 kilometres east of Regina on the Trans-Canada Highway. The town is primarily populated by urban professionals escaping the high property taxes of Regina.
Community profile
According to the 2001 Statistics Canada census:
| Population: | 1,013 (+11.7% from 1996) |
| Land area: | 2.06 km² |
| Population density: | 490.7 people/km² |
| Median age: | 35.9 (males: 35.7, females: 36.0) |
| Total private dwellings: | 311 |
| Median household income: | $77,368 |
